Beach seeks council at-large position in Dunkirk election

Frank Beach

Community activist and Dunkirk resident Frank Beach is the Democratic and Working Family Party endorsed candidate for the city of Dunkirk Councilman At Large position in the upcoming 2019 election.

He was raised in Dunkirk and is a Cardinal Mindszenty High School graduate. After graduating from college and a successful music career, he relocated to his wife’s hometown in Indiana, where they raised their family There he retired in 2016 as the President of a National Financial Services corporation and, with his wife, moved back to his hometown of Dunkirk.

Since returning, he has focused his full time availability and energy on the vision and a determination to be involved and invested in his hometown’s resurgence and quality growth. To that end, in December 2018, he initiated the advocacy for keeping Brooks Hospital on Central Avenue in Dunkirk, a fight he is not willing to give up. As a visionary, he believes in the need for training, education and child care availability as a city and county wide priority; this will provide a sustainable qualified local workforce insuring the retention and longevity of new industry, retail and service providers in support of continued future city growth.

“We must continue to work with our area’s employers, educators and post high school campuses to provide opportunities to insure local residents have the training and skills necessary to compete for and be successful in obtaining the jobs of the future,” Beach says. “We must have a qualified workforce to fill the jobs and affordable and available childcare for our working families.”

As a member of Revitalize Dunkirk, the board of directors of CHRIC and with extensive experience and knowledge in real estate and finance, Beach will work to expand homeownership and rehabilitation opportunities for all residents. He will look to manage, with enhanced guidelines and restrictions, absentee landlord and other rental property investors with reserve requirements, a “First Look” purchase program for owner occupying buyers and down payment assistance programs.

As for his music career, he formed “The Rising” a project, focused on promoting the city of Dunkirk and its residents. This has provided the opportunity to donate time and energy to several organizations and benefit events in support of area residents and group’s needs. He is a member of the First Ward Falcons, Knights of Columbus, Kosciuszko Club, Columbus Club and a supporter of Dunkirk Historical Society, Polka Fest, Beach Clean Up, National Night Out and many other civic events promoting Dunkirk.

Beach brings a no-nonsense, business oriented, full time availability and willingness to serve all the residents of Dunkirk.

“I am an outspoken advocate for independent thinking, total transparency, open lines of communication and collaboration,” Beach adds. “I won’t hesitate to disagree or to state my opposing opinion when I believe the best interests of the residents are not being served. I will always work toward progress for our city and ensure that prosperity and pride are evident in all that we do.”
